Update- New House

Since my last post we have made a major life change. We left our little ranch that we put our blood, sweat and tears into for another fixer upper. I went back through my posts and saw this I wrote back in June.  It was about the house we ended up buying. After I wrote this post, the house went on the market. It sat for a while. In the meantime, we went under contract on two other houses that ended up not working out. This house was always in the back of my head. 


There is a lot of good. I am a sucker for a Williamsburg colonial. I see dormers and dentil molding- I melt. It is on a cul-de-sac in a great school district.  Most importantly, it really feels like home to us. 
 There is a beautiful formal living room and it has old pine floors. 

With the good, comes some bad. Like knotty pine walls... 



 green carpet... 

 original appliances from the 60's. 

We have already done so much to make it feel like home. I cannot wait to share our projects with you.
